Christian Carpéné is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Christian Carpéné has authored 160 papers receiving a total of 5.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 89 papers in Molecular Biology, 85 papers in Physiology and 45 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Christian Carpéné’s work include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(65 papers), Microbial metabolism and enzyme function (55 papers) and Biochemical Acid Research Studies (40 papers). Christian Carpéné is often cited by papers focused on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(65 papers), Microbial metabolism and enzyme function (55 papers) and Biochemical Acid Research Studies (40 papers). Christian Carpéné collaborates with scholars based in France, Spain and United States. Christian Carpéné's co-authors include Philippe Valet, Max Lafontan, Isabelle Castan‐Laurell, Josep Mercader, Danièle Daviaud, Jérémie Boucher, Charlotte Guigné, D. Prévot, M Berlan and Luc Marti and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Cell Metabolism and Diabetes.
